If you're the type who used to eat sour sweets until your mouth genuinely ached, Blue Sour Raspberry on the IVG Smart Max Vape Kit was built with you in mind. This isn't a gentle, rounded berry flavour. It's got a proper pucker to it, the kind that makes your jaw tighten slightly on the first couple of pulls, and that sharpness is the entire point.
The opening hit is dominated by a tart, almost fizzy sourness that lands fast, more sherbet than fresh fruit. Underneath that sharp edge sits a proper raspberry sweetness, but it takes a second or two to register because the sourness gets there first and grabs all the attention. As you keep vaping, something interesting happens: the sourness doesn't fully disappear, but your mouth adjusts to it, so what felt sharp on pull one starts to feel more like a background tingle by pull ten, and the raspberry sweetness gets more room to come through. The exhale carries a candied, almost boiled-sweet raspberry note with a light sour dusting still clinging to the edges, similar to the coating on a sour raspberry belt rather than the taste of an actual raspberry off the bush.
This flavour suits people who find most fruit vapes a bit soft and want something with actual bite to it. It's a strong choice for anyone who grew up on sour sweets, or who deliberately avoids sweeter, rounder flavours because they find them boring after a while. Time of day matters more with this one than with a lot of flavours. It works well as a wake-up-your-senses option, useful when you want something that genuinely grabs your attention, but it's not the flavour to reach for last thing before bed, since the sharpness can feel a bit much when you're trying to wind down rather than perk up.
It's worth being clear about how this differs from IVG's own Blue Razz Lemonade, since the names sound close enough to cause confusion. Where the lemonade version balances sweetness with a light citrus fizz, Blue Sour Raspberry skips the citrus route entirely and goes straight for tartness instead, so the two land quite differently despite sharing a blue raspberry base. Against other sour vape flavours on the market, this one is more consistent than most; a lot of "sour" e-liquids front-load the tartness in the first couple of pulls and then fade into plain sweetness, whereas this holds a steadier sour thread through most of a pod's life rather than mellowing out too quickly. Compared to sour apple or sour watermelon styles, the raspberry base gives it a deeper, more candied character rather than the sharper, more citrus-adjacent bite those other fruits tend to bring.
